When Igor Sikorsky filed U.S. Patent 1994488 on March 19, 1935, the helicopter was still mostly fantasy. Airplane designers had conquered the skies with fixed wings and propellers; the idea of a machine that could hover, rise straight up, and drift sideways seemed to violate every law engineers held dear. Yet Sikorsky, a Russian-born aviator and engineer working in Connecticut, saw something others couldn't: the mathematics of vertical flight hiding inside rotating discs.

The patent drawing itself is a portrait of that vision. Radial lines spiral outward from the rotor hub, each one a vector of lift and control. Elevations show the fuselage from multiple angles, mechanical details rendered with the precision of a watchmaker. This wasn't just a sketch; it was a blueprint for rethinking how machines could move through air.

Sikorsky's helicopter patent arrived at a moment when aviation was reshaping civilization. The 1930s had already given the world transcontinental flying boats and sleek cabin aircraft. But those machines still needed runways. Sikorsky imagined something more: a ship that could rise from a parking lot, hover over a rooftop, land in a field. The geometry on this page would eventually make that dream real.
